Abstract

The next generation network, TWAREN, provides the wideband network service and guarantees qualities of services (QoS). Likewise, it embraces the mechanism of SLA which guarantees for QoS claimed. The research exploits PDF and CDF in the statistics and probability to estimate the likely index of QoS. We also compare the performances of the Production network with Research network and try to comprehend which factors may cause the pulses on the plots. Consequently, we observe that AvgRTT is lower 1.5%, PLR gets lower 42% and Availability is higher 0.08% as compared to Production network. Ultimately, we recommend that TWAREN network can draft Average RTT as 9.44ms, PLR as 0.89% and Availability as 99%. These metrics can supply the related policies of network management and the service operations for TWAREN in the future.
